My refrigerator is running and not cold enough, what are some things that I could check for ?
Refrigerator not cooling as it should? These are the top 10 possible causes:
- Thermostat set incorrectly
- Restricted air flow
- Electrical issues
- Damaged gaskets
- Defective frost system
- Coolant leak
- Bad compressor
- Dirty condenser
- Faulty start relay
- Blocked or broken fans

A – Some quick and easy stuff to check for is… 1) Are the interior lights shutting off when the doors are closed…2) Are the doors closing properly and the gaskets sealing as well…3) Is the fan in the freezer running…4) Is the condenser fan running at the back bottom of the fridge…5) Is the condenser coils in need of cleaning For more specific refrigeration info please see the refrigerator pages.
